Description
Abilene photographer Bill Wright worked among and studied the Tigua Indians of Ysleta, Texas, for more than six years, making his own distinguished images and collecting documentary photographs of the tribe from among the Tigua themselves and from sources across the United States. His research in their history, his interviews with Tigua leaders, tribal members, and his magnificent collection of photographs, rare historical pictures and his own incomparable contemporary images, combine to make a unique modern study of these, the oldest Texans. Included is an extensive bibliography of sources and a list of Tigua tribal officers and members. - from Amzon
